3. Internet in Education
The researcher will also discuss about the nature of Internet. This discussion is needed to know whether the use of Internet leads to good perception or bad perception.
Internet -is also well known as Net- is the biggest computer network in the world

In writing, Internet provides students references, an up – to- date articles to support their learning to write. Teeler and Peta 2000: 17 say, “Internet is considered
as a reference library for continuing development in language teaching”. For writing class, internet is beneficial and helps the students in doing the writing exercises. They
can get several paper models and sufficient knowledge to write. For them, Internet can be a source of learning materials. Teeler and Peta 2000: 36 state, “There are three
advantages of the Internet as a source learning material. They are: scope, topicality, and personalization”.
By using Internet, the students can find amount of source and materials which support them in doing their writing tasks. The students also get today’s new or up-to-
date information without buying them. Every information in the Internet is being added everyday. Teeler and Peta 2000:36 say, “Everything the students want to write,
Internet provides it”. In writing, students may have to have a topic to be discussed. The topics they deal may be irrelevant or difficult to discuss. Students may sometimes need
alternative topics. They 2000:36 add, “Internet can provide so many topics you can choose”.
